
Nielsen is out with their top 10 mobile games for the U.S. operator market in 2008. As you’re about to see, classic titles like Tetris, Bejeweled and Pac-Man still rock. Without further ado, here’s the list:
- 7.0% – Tetris
- 4.0% – Bejeweled
- 3.6% – Guitar Hero III
- 2.6% – Wheel of Fortune
- 2.5% – Pac-Man
- 1.9% – The Oregon Trail
- 1.7% – Ms. Pac-Man
- 1.6% – Are You Smarter Than…
- 1.6% – Tetris Mania
- 1.2% – Surviving High School
Saw that? That’s Tetris and Pac-Man times two!! Guess, people keep preferring casual gaming on their mobiles…
